Spot the Invaders: Identifying Common Pests

πŸ•·οΈ Spider Mites: The Tiny Web Weavers

Fine webs beneath leaves and a speckled look on foliage are telltale signs of spider mites. To combat them, wipe down leaves with a damp cloth or use a water spray to disrupt their habitat. Boosting humidity is also effective, as spider mites despise moisture.

🦠 Scale: The Sticky Bandits

Scale insects masquerade as harmless bumps on stems and leaves, but they're really sap-sucking pests. Manual removal with a brush or cloth is a good start. For stubborn cases, a cotton swab dipped in rubbing alcohol can help. Prevent future invasions with regular applications of insecticidal soap.

🦟 Fungus Gnats and Fruit Flies: The Soil Lurkers

These pests hint at overwatered soil. Spot larvae and adult flies to confirm their presence. Reduce watering and let the soil dry to discourage them. Yellow sticky traps can catch adults, while a layer of sand on the soil surface can prevent larvae from emerging.

πŸ› Mealybugs: The Fluffy White Destroyers

Cottony clusters in leaf crevices signal a mealybug infestation. Alcohol wipes are the bouncer for these pests, while a mix of neem oil and insecticidal soap can clear larger infestations. Regular plant inspections are crucial for early detection and control.

Keeping Bugs at Bay: Preventative Tips

πŸ’§ The Right Watering Routine

Overwatering is the archenemy of Aloe 'Crosby's Prolific'. To keep your soil from becoming a bug nightclub, water only when the top inch is dry. Think of it as the plant's subtle nudge rather than a desperate plea for hydration.
